Pets desperately looking for homes


 
Ben & Max Labrador
elgar

Extra Info:

We are desperately looking for a lovely home for two lab boys aged 5 (Max, yellow Lab) and 9 (Ben, black Lab).

They need to stay together as the older one suffers from really bad separation anxiety.

Ben: The big brother; 9 1/2 years old but looks and acts half his age. Beautiful black, shiny coat and remarkably fit. A gentle giant, well mannered, acts on commands and loves Max to bits. Has no problems around people but is more interested in playing with his own kind, loves streams and park waste bins.

Max: A yellow, stocky boy (not fat) of 5 years. Bought as a companion for Ben, Max is the opposite in as much he prefers humans. All he wants is a cuddle and is extremely affectionate. He has epilepsy but is on medication and has not fitted for some time. He has no problems around other dogs. He too acts on commands and loves Ben to bits. He just loves to be fussed.

Both of these boys are beautifully well behaved/mannered and love going for walks. As they are big boys experienced families only are recommended.
